  • Patent number: 4594466
    Abstract: A process for the separation of weak organic acids such as ethanol or methanol from dilute aqueous solutions thereof. The process comprises dissolving in the solution an amount of at least 26 grams/100 ml of solution of a base or a basic salt, such as potassium carbonate, the conjugate acid of which has a pKa value of above 6 and which has a solubility of at least 26 grams/100 ml. of solution and is substantially more soluble in water than in the organic acid, and separating from the solution a phase rich in the organic acid and an aqueous phase rich in the base or basic salt. The process is particularly applicable to the separation of ethanol from fermentation media as the high ionic strength of the dissolved base or basic salt causes flocculation of the dissolved solids component of dunder.

  • Patent number: 4508873
    Abstract: Emulsions of hydrocarbon liquids such as automotive distillate and water, or water and alcohols, are formed using an emulsifier which is a block copolymer of ethylene oxide type monomers and styrene type monomers. The stability of the emulsions is improved by the addition to the emulsion of a coupling agent which is soluble in the continuous phase of the emulsion and will couple with that portion of the emulsifier which is solvated by the continuous phase of the emulsion. Preferred coupling agents for water in oil type emulsions are copolymers of butadiene and styrene.
